Yes , it is more difficult to get in and out of (but much easier than the Viper) and the interior room is tighter. But those weren't deal breakers in of any sort. The C7 is an awesome car in EVERY way! But SO is the ZL1! I was considering the ZL1 when I bought the C7 and a year ago, you couldn't find a C7 on a lot anywhere. The C7 is a beautiful car with serious performance along with build quality and attitude to match. But i had owned mine for a little over a year at this point and when the 20% off offer popped up on the ZL1, I knew that - for me - it was the time to trade. I actually had been looking at ZL1s for ~the last month, having been bitten by the F-body bug again. And the things the ZL1 offered my C7 did not have. 580 HP, a blown LS motor, mag ride, dual mode exhaust, ZL1 looks, two more seats, bigger tires and wheels, and an even more aggressive look to me. Those reasons are in no way a criticism of the C7. But they ARE are the same things that had me on the fence a year ago between a C7 and the Camaro. This ZL1 came in a little over a week ago as a stock unit, I'm the only one that has driven it (other than the dealer service tech for delivery prep), it is the right color (for me), the massive rebate popped up, the dealer is less than 30 minutes from my house, and the numbers were ridiculously to my advantage so I pulled the trigger. It was the right car, the right deal, and a great dealer that just added ice cream to my cake. And the Viper? Just drive one and you will see why that snake is pure badass. I loved that car too.
